Venture capitalists have played a pivotal role in hatching the technologies that are redefining our work and life. Alongside the brilliant innovators who dream up the ideas, VC's contribute the business acumen and development capital that feeds Silicon Valley. And it is through this process of high-stakes investing that unimaginable fortunes are made. The VC Way is the first book to take readers into this private world of extreme investing, showing how seasoned, successful VC's prosper in down markets as well as during high times. For those who want to invest like the best, it reveals their unique strategies, sectors they are tracking, screens and criteria, best and worst investments, and how individuals can use the lessons they've learned. Packed with insider's advice and fascinating stories, The VC Way contains accounts from some of the most influential and noteworthy venture capitalists in business today-Ann Winblad of Hummer Winblad, Neil Weintraut of 21st Century Internet, and dozens of others. The VC Way is an invaluable resource for anyone who wants to match strategies with these master investors.
